#d432c3 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d432c3 is composed of 83.1% red, 19.6% green and 76.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 76.4% magenta, 8%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 306.3 degrees, a saturation of 65.3% and a lightness of 51.4%. #d432c3 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ff64ff with #a90087.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

Shades and Tints of #d432c3
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060105 is the darkest color, while #fdf5f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#d432c3
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#887e87 is the less saturated color, while #fa0ce1 is the most saturated one.
